What is Six Sigma? I think firstly we should ask this question to ourselves. Six Sigma is a process of identifying and defining the variation in our production process and of finding correct techniques to minimize them. It was first established by Motorola in 1986, and in a short period of time, it was started to be used by many other big and middle size companies. For example, General Electric (GE) is one of the most popular and the biggest followers of this process under the authority of the company's legendary CEO Jack Welch. Also, as he has stated, "in such a big supply chain which GE has, embracing Six Sigma brings the help and the support to suppliers and the most importantly customers."


What are the rules and six steps for Six Sigma? What kind of advantages does it bring to our organization? First of all, we should clarify that Six Sigma is a way of checking quality by identifying and counting the defects (errors) in a production process. If a company is aiming for minimized deviation and applying Six Sigma into its process, the company managers from bottom to top have to understand the importance of making each employee in the organization understand what Six Sigma means, and how and why they are applying this method into their production process. Also, all employees including especially top managers must believe in the process and take it in a serious way. Secondly, we always aim customer satisfaction by applying Six Sigma which means that Customers are our target. Customers have to get the non-defected productions. By the same token, Six Sigma helps us minimize the deviation. Once Jack Welch has said that "deviation is an evil for the company". What he means is that deviation (errors, defects) has to be got rid of or at least minimized to satisfy the customers even though we know that whatever happens in a production process, defects are always going to happen. Hence, how much we are minimizing the defects is the important question. "Keep the process on target by reducing variation to satisfy the customers." is the popular saying of Six Sigma.

Edirne, the city of Sultans

Edirne, one of my most favorite cities in Turkey. To be honest, I have seen many cities, especially in Europe, but I have never seen such a warm and friendly city that much. Before I came to the US, I used to take daily trips to that beautiful city just to get a relief and escape from the chaos of the biggest city in Turkey, Istanbul. I know that this subject is way different from my usual entries, but I just want to write about it particularly because I miss it a lot.

Firstly, Edirne is such an old city which is known not only for its popularity as a capital for Ottoman Empire, but also for its architectural beauties that have been mostly built by Mimar Sinan (1489-1588)

When you go to that beautiful city, the magnificent artifact, Selimiye Mosque welcomes you from wherever you get into the city because it is so huge that you could see it from each corner. Also, during the night it has a gorgeous view which I call absolutely breathtaking.

It is still one of the greatest mosques in the world and I believe so that it would keep its reputation for a long time by exciting many domestic and foreign people. One of the other things that I like about the city is that it has a famous museum designed in a creative way and considered the best museum in Europe. The first time I have heart about it, I told myself that I had to see that place, and I just took the train and went there. Hopefully and thankfully, I did that because it was such a calm and peaceful place. It used to be a clinic for those who had mental diseases during the Ottoman Empire period. The doctors of that treatment center believed that the music was the strongest way of healing people and making them find the solutions in their hearts.



Folks, can you imagine such a clinic, where you get treated by music and the sound of water which is dropping continuously? It is so cool and when you get inside, you see the whole room in a kind of panoramic view. Each patient's room is separated from each other in a pentagonal shape and the fountain is located in the middle of the room. Also, the musicians' place is located so close to the fountain, and the echo is very good, so each patient can listen to the music to get cured. Of course, one has to mention about the great rivers of Edirne when talking about that gorgeous city, called Arda, Tunca, and Meriç which are connected to each other and go through the city. Meriç is the biggest and the longest one among them and it draws the border between Greece and Turkey. Southwest Airlines' Success and Gary Kelly as a CEO



Today I would like to talk about a legend in airline industry, Southwest Airlines. It is a well know airlines not only in the US, but also all around the world with its huge profits and permanent success being the most profitable airline in the world. At this point, I should add one more thing that Southwest does not mostly fly overseas. Although its flight range is limited by US, it can still be the most profitable airline. Just one question comes into our minds: How do they do that?

Of course, there are many different kinds of answers to this question, but I would like to mention one of the most important for the sake of the airline, the CEO, Gary Kelly. He is the guy who keeps Southwest one of the best airlines in the world with its forecasting, emotional, and comprehensive skills. He started working as an accountant and he never thought that he would have got CEO position one day, but he did. What are the gems that he has in order to keep the company the best one?

Recently, as all of us know, the world has suffered from gas prices, and it was one of the worst periods not only for all different kinds of industries in the world, but also, especially, for airline industry. However, even though many companies' sales have extremely fallen down, Southwest managed to be the best even at that time. The important factor and name was Gary Kelly, the guy who realized what was coming up, petroleum crisis. He made fuel hedging contracts and kept the fuel price much lower than the current rising price and that smartest attempt made the company be able to keep ticket prices low as well in comparison to the other airline companies' prices. I think this strategy brought such a big advantage to the company, and it still is taking advantage of the hedge contract while other companies are still trying to put their budgets together.



Secondly, he has great communicating skills. He tries to know everybody in his company and whenever he takes a ride, he never uses first class. Instead, he always prefers leaving the front seats to the customers, and he travels with his wife at the back side, which is the loudest part on a plane. Moreover, He is a humble guy who can get into communication with all kinds of people either from his staff or from his customers.

The last advantage of the company I would like to add is its plane types. For example, when we look at Delta airlines' planes, we realize that they have all kinds of different planes from a wide range mostly being used for the flights to overseas. However, Southwest has a clear understanding and policy about their planes. "We are trying to be the best airline fliying with the lowest fares, so we have to keep our prices low and the first we can do is to keep our planes in one or two kinds, so we can reduce our maintenance cost and the repair time." Hence, the company has mostly Boeing 737 to apply this smart policy and guys it works so well because Southwest's success mostly comes from its reduced flight costs.
